Overall, I did not dislike this book, but it was definitely hard to get through at times. Parts of the plot were very interesting. It was interesting to see how much Dorian changed over the course of the book (he started off very nice and ended up being so obsessed with staying young and he ended up being a social outcast). And it was interesting to read about how Dorian kept the painting so locked up (it was a bit intriguing because I didn’t know if someone was going to discover the painting). Also, the characters were very distinct. Basil was so in love with Dorian that he would’ve done ANYTHING for him, even after Dorian had pushed Basil away. Lord Henry was so weird and had strange, backwards thoughts about life. And Basil changed a lot during the book (he tried to gain redemption at the end). Despite some parts of the book being interesting and the writing being GREAT, it was very slow. There wasn’t necessarily a lot of plot, and the writing dragged on sometimes. Some dialogue took up an entire page. And some WHOLE CHAPTERS were dedicated to describing random things (one whole chapter mentioned everything Dorian collected and the characters of a book he read). Because so many parts were slow and so consuming, I found the book very much difficult to get through. Despite this, it was all well written and the characters were memorable. It would be interesting to later read a censored version and see how different the two are.
